Loading [MathJax]/extensions/tex2jax.js
Filter Class Reference

More...

+ Inheritance diagram for Filter:

Classes

class  ReadAccess
 
class  WriteAccess
 

Public Member Functions

def __init__ (self, text, writeAccess=WriteAccess.none, readAccess=ReadAccess.coordinatesAttributes)
 
def clone (self)
 
def validate (self, geom, basePoint=None)
 

Detailed Description

Constructor & Destructor Documentation

◆ __init__()

def __init__ (   self,
  text,
  writeAccess = WriteAccess.none,
  readAccess = ReadAccess.coordinatesAttributes 
)
Parameters
self(type: object) self pointer
text(type: str) mandatory parameter
writeAccess(type: WriteAccess) optional parameter
readAccess(type: ReadAccess) optional parameter
Returns
(type: object)

Member Function Documentation

◆ clone()

def clone (   self)
Parameters
self(type: Filter) self pointer
Returns
(type: Filter)

◆ validate()

def validate (   self,
  geom,
  basePoint = None 
)
Parameters
self(type: Filter) self pointer
geom(type: Geometry) mandatory parameter
basePoint(type: Point) optional parameter
Returns
(type: bool)